Love Is Confusing

Oh love is confusing, it has many definitions, many tales of both fiction and non-fiction, She loves him, he loves her, BUT WAIT! They both love someone else? No true love anymore, now it is like a compass with a dial that spines out of control, Go West- Go North- East- and South- ...Yes- south toward the devils, never north to paradise- Love is confusing, (a confession believed a lie- See her now cry!) He slaps her, she sleeps with another guy; an endless game, an endless war, back and forth (tug of war) so true, yet so fake, yet so brilliantly acted out (watch the tear- oh how convincing- watch the slap- oh that must have hurt-) tonight I go to bed, resting my head upon my pillow, and look up and see the faces of my past women and I think of where they are at right then. All I know is they're not with me, and that is just confusing. .12.19.2013.
